martinp said:
Reading high must be an Audi thing - my old TT and my wife's A2 both always read about 5 mph high.


I think over-reading is normal on most cars - by law I think they're allowed to over-read by up to 10%, and from a liability point of view manufacturers probably prefer to do this, rather than someone sueing them because they went past a Gatso at an indicated 30 and got fined due to speedo under-reading.

I have regularly found with my RA in a variety of cars that they over-read between 5-10mph at higher speeds
